Is Obernai worth visiting?
As a medieval free town and then an imperial town of the Décapole alliance, as well as the legendary birthplace of St Odile, patron saint of Alsace, Obernai epitomises the rich heritage of Alsace. What is the walled city near Colmar?
Neuf-Brisach Fortified Town. Neuf-Brisach is the Citadel of the Sun King since it was founded in 1699 at Louis XIV's behest. Today, it is considered as Vauban's masterpiece. What is the poorest village in France?
In November 2020, Grigny was ranked as the poorest town in mainland France by the Observatory on poverty (Observatoire de Lutte contre la Pauvreté), with a poverty rate of 45% (compared with 14.6% nationally).What is the most beautiful village in the south of France?
